How To Pay Taxes With PayPal
Paying taxes with PayPal is a very simple process. Those are:
-File your taxes.
- To begin making your tax payments, visit payUSAtax com3 or ACI Payments, Inc 2 and follow the prompts to pay your federal taxes.
- Pay with PayPal, or choose PayPal Credit as your payment type to get special financing.
On tax payments of $99 or more, you can get special financing for 6 months with PayPal Credit. The ACI Payments, Inc. platform is used to process all PayPal payments made to fed acipayonline com and acipayonline com. For using this service, a convenience fee will be assessed by ACI Payments, Inc. No portion of this fee is paid to the IRS. Your card or bank statement will show all costs. The payment method you choose will determine the amount of your Convenience Fee. PayPal charges a fixed fee of $2.20 for debit card transactions and 1.98% (minimum $2.50) of the tax liability amount for credit card transactions.
The WorldPay platform is used to process every PayPal payment made to payUSAtax com. When using this service, WorldPay's service provider, Value Payment Systems, LLC, will impose a convenience fee. No portion of this fee is paid to the IRS. Your card or bank statement will show all costs. The payment method you choose will determine the amount of your Convenience Fee. For debit or ATM/Debit transactions, the fee will be a flat rate of $2.55; for PayPal, it will be 1.96% (with a minimum of $2.69).
